What Is a Car Key Programmer?
A car key programmer is an electronic device that communicates with a vehicle's onboard computer system or Electronic Control Unit (ECU) to program keys, fobs, and transponder chips. These devices are essential for developing new keys for cars, especially when original keys are lost or damaged. Depending on the type of vehicle and key innovation, various programmers are available, each developed to work with specific makes and models.
Types of Car Key Programmers
Car key programmers can be categorized based upon their functionalities, compatibility, and operational methodologies. Here are a few of the typical types:

Standalone Programmers:
These devices do not need any additional equipment. They are developed to straight connect to the car's OBD-II port and are user-friendly, generally featuring a built-in screen.
PC-Based Programmers:
These types require to be linked to a computer. They typically use advanced functions and can support a broader series of car designs through software updates.
Smartphone-based Programmers:
Utilizing mobile applications, these programmers connect to automobiles by means of Bluetooth or Wi-Fi. They use a portable solution for key programming but may be limited in their capabilities compared to standalone or PC-based alternatives.Key Functions of Car Key Programmers
Understanding the functionalities of Car Key Programer key programmers can help users comprehend what they can accomplish with these devices:

Using a car key programmer includes a series of actions. The following is a generalized procedure for utilizing a standalone key programmer:
Step-by-Step Guide:Connect the Programmer: Plug the key programmer into the vehicle's OBD-II port.Turn on the Ignition: Turn on the vehicle's ignition without beginning the engine.Select Vehicle Make and Model: Follow the on-screen prompts to pick the appropriate vehicle make and design.Program the Key: Choose the alternative to program a brand-new key or fob, then follow the prompts.Test the Key: After programming, test the key to guarantee it operates correctly (lock/unlock doors, begin the engine).Safety PrecautionsAlways ensure the vehicle battery is adequately charged throughout programming.Handle keys and fobs with care to prevent damage.Advantages of Using a Car Key Programmer

Do I require a car key programmer if I have lost my only key?
Yes, a car key programmer is often important for reprogramming brand-new keys after losing the only set.
2. Can any car key programmer work with my vehicle?
Not all programmers are compatible with every vehicle. Constantly ensure the programmer you are buying is designed for your specific make and design.
3. Can I reprogram utilized keys with a car key programmer?
In the majority of cases, yes. However, some cars need the old key to be cleared from the system initially.
4. How do I know if I need a transponder key programmer particularly?
If your vehicle uses a transponder key system, you will need a programmer that supports transponders.
